Born on March 7, 1975, in Boston, Massachusetts, Thyne's journey into the world of acting began in his youth. He would attend high school in Plano, Texas, graduating in 1993 before moving to Los Angeles to pursue higher education and his acting aspirations. His career, however, is far from a one-hit wonder. The impact of "Bones" on Thyne's career cannot be overstated. As Dr. Jack Hodgins, the eccentric, often conspiratorial, and always insightful entomologist, botanist, and mineralogist, he provided a comedic foil to the more stoic characters. Thyne brought Hodgins to life in 246 episodes, showcasing his ability to blend humor, intelligence, and underlying vulnerability. This role, which started in 2005 and ran until the show's conclusion in 2017, allowed him to establish himself as a familiar face in the television landscape. T.J. Thyne's professional life has not been without its more personal notes. For instance, Thyne was in a relationship with his "Bones" co-star, Michaela Conlin, with whom he was engaged for three years until their separation in 2011. The split came as a surprise to some, but the decision had already been made by the couple.
